Is the triumph of the failure?
The title of the exhibition “From the relative truth to the absolute error” works as metaphor about both philosophic and scientific concepts, playing with the notions of absolute and relative truth, the error as a kind of element of measure, between relativism and dialectic.
Today, the errors, and failures are confronting permanently with the social pressure to follow the preconception of the stereotyped ideas of successful and perfection, as main motor of the all social life in the contemporary western societies.
This exhibition is a manifesto, is a kind of answer against the passivity and scepticism, apparently related with the residual position of relativism imposed during decadent decades of post-modernism. Is a trigger to introduce the audience into the International Errorist movement, entering inside a labyrinth of errors, and failures which is basically based in an empiric research in the daily own life. Front of the usually unmotivated audience of the art media, is time to recover our most beautiful contradictions and try try to shake again the mass movement of multitudes of consumers with the fear to fail, or just afraid to take incorrect decisions.

“Truth and error, like all thought-concepts which move in polar opposites, have absolute validity only in an extremely limited field… as first elements of dialectics, which deal precisely with the inadequacy of all polar opposites. As soon as we apply the antithesis between truth and error outside of that narrow field which has been referred to above it becomes relative and therefore unserviceable for exact scientific modes of expression; and if we attempt to apply it as absolutely valid outside that field we really find ourselves altogether beaten: both poles of the antithesis become transformed into their opposites, truth becomes error and error truth” F. Engels, Anti-Dühring , Moscow, 1959, p. 127. p. 135 Source: MATERIALISM and EMPIRIO-CRITICISM http://www.marxists.org/archive/lenin/works/1908/mec/ two5.htm#bkV14E052
Errorist World Map http://www.smartprojectspace.

Entering to the first room, the head/heart of the exhibition, this map is a geopolitically uncorrected representation which doesn’t try to find accurate data. A game of representation of another possible cartographies, where the world is reversed , and the point of view depend of an imperfect drawing in an “glocal” attempt of networks in the erratic lives of this movement.
On the installation you can find all the clues needed to find you on the path of error-ism. This is also, a place to remember the glorious moment of the foundation of this movement and how was spreading around the all world. Is an space to discover how some errorist cells in the southern cone of Latin America, currently carried out more than five years of propaganda campaigns, actions and erratic distribution of knowledge, through texts printed on the walls of Brian Holmes, Stephen Wright, Franco Berardi (Bifo) among others.

Error Arsenal http://www.smartprojectspace.
By mistake a lovely arsenal was discovered in an undercover headquarters of the "international errorist" which was raided. Fortunately no one had to escape, but all of them escaped. Three dozen hand grenades hand painted, stuttering singer’s revolvers, erotic Keffiyehs, mix language manifestos, enormous flags and illusions about the new revolutions are lying on the table.
The secret bureau is not only imaginary. It’s here, around us, we can play with toys like children’s ... if we can imagine or believe, just for one second, that representation is reality and reality is representation.

How an organization operates with these erratic characteristics?
Where is the symbolic value behind the images? Could be possible to “use” the imagination?
Installation. Collection of objects used in the actions to repudiate the visit of George W Bush for the “Fourth summit of the Americas” in Mar del Plata, Argentina, 4 - 5 November, 2005.

The Errorist Kabaret http://www.smartprojectspace.
The installation was commissioned in 2009 during a residency in Turkey at Platform Garanti in Istanbul, as part of the 11th Istanbul Biennial “What keeps mankind alive?” a sentence taken from Bertolt Brecht and Kurt Weil play The Threepenny Opera.
The installation is composed of more than 30 paintings set inside a theatre stage surrounded by various life-sized characters, called 'gente armada', which means both 'armed' and 'constructed' people, representing different personalities from Turkey and other parts of the world in a surreal discussion about hopes and desires which takes place between intellectuals, artists, revolutionaries and people speaking with desirable objects. Hearing the opinion of a bottle of wine, a teacup or an ashtray creates a comedy of socio-political reality from an unconstrained, errorist perspective discussing the paradigmatic situation of avant garde representation today. The theatrical stage is open, leaving protagonism to the common audience and participation between the artworks, tables and cardboard figures distributed everywhere. Here bottles can think, tables chat with paintings, glasses drink, people and ashtrays are always full of poetry. The room is full; there is a special show today, welcome to the Errorist Kabaret!

Museum Songspiel – The Netherlands 20XX (Space 6) by Chto Delat?
The Revolutions through affect: "From Relative Truth to the Absolute Error" comes as continuity of the exhibition showed previously “What is to be done? Between Tragedy and Farce” by Chto Delat? (what is to be done?) platform. The collaboration between Etcetera… and Chto Delat? started about five years ago, the 1th may of 2005, during the debates celebrated in the framework of the exhibition “Collective Creativity” curate by the curatorial collective WHW (What How and for Whom) in Friedericianum Museum in Kassel, Germany. In that poetic politic laboratory a “Russian Tango” cocktail has born, and since then a more dynamic dialogue between both collectives in different formats of collaborations like magazines, conferences, exhibitions or midnight assemblies.
